BossMac's Get Backers Tv Review

Get Backers

Get Backers tv Review

Story & Characters

Dakkanya GetBackers is the story of the duo of Midou Ban and Amano Ginji. They get back anything stolen and guarantees a 100% success rate. They are retrieval experts by trade and very skilled fighters at heart. Case are reported to them by clients or by their agent. It is during this mission that they end up mixing it out with various hindrances and enemies. To combat this obstacles, Midou Ban has the power of Aesculapius the Serpent Holder which utilizes his 200 kg (440 lbs) gripping power to subdue enemies. Plus he has the Curse of the Evil Eye which enables him to make anyone who looks at his eyes hallucinate for an exact minute (60 sec) hence his nickname Otoko no Jagan (Man with the Evil Eye). Amano Ginji, known as Raitei in the Mugenjou area, has the power of lightning and electricity in his side along with the tenacity of a cat. He was a former leader of the Volts. As the story progresses, more difficult missions are given to them requiring the aid of other retrieval and delivery specialists.

Overall the story is great, packed with lots action and a twisted tale of loyalty, trust and betrayal. Too much twists and unnecessary events hinder GetBackers and will only confuse viewers with narrow comprehension.

Art

Both the anime and manga deliver pretty good character design. The anime features very visually pleasing colors. Character presentation via their choice of attire is awesome too, though the idea still hurts that they re-use their clothes over and over again. Fight scenes are well-rendered highlighting the center of attention when its needed the most. Details are fairly well done with the background not getting cut-off from the attention as most of the comedy happens there. Character transitions from a serious look to a more entertaining look is very pleasing mainly Ginji and his Tare Panda parody.

Art is one of the strong point of this anime boasting a nice array of colorful eye candy for everyone. Beware of the fanservice known as HEVN.

Sound

Dakkanya GetBackers' soundtracks features the best of what an anime has to offer in terms of sound. The opening and ending themes are listeners' choice and are very interesting. Artists like the great Otoha, Bon Bon Blanco and Pierrot have all contributed to make this anime a listening experience for the viewer. Plot-wise, the sound effects are very engrossing and gives the viewer a feeling of involvement. Character BGMs are finely suited to their respective characters, emanating their aura via the music alone.

Overall, a very good experience for the human auditory organ.

Presentation

The presentation is very well thought-of and cleanly laid out. The idea is not new but GetBackers lived up to its expectations and made the genre a little better. The transition from easy missions to much more difficult ones are clearly highlighted. The humour is instilled into each character making them very lovable in their own way. Viewers will be fighting over which character is the best. The viewing experience will make anyone tune-in up until the end. The fight scenes are very fast-paced and will appeal to action fans very much.

Overall presentation is very good. The humour is great. There is no lack of action. This anime will make you love anime even more. Very good transition from manga to TV series. An attempt that didn't fail. Good job to the creators.

The downside: Most male fans would not approve of the man to man relationship that the anime exudes in one way or another.Fanservice is not too much of an issue, having only one character to blame for all that ecchi stuff. But this is a must buy, a legend in its own right.
